Losing between 50 and 100 hairs every day is regular, however shedding considerably greater than that may signal a problem.

Roughly one-third of women expertise feminine sample hair loss, or androgenetic alopecia, in some unspecified time in the future of their lives, and it turns into more and more possible as you age. In reality, a 2022 study discovered that 52.2% of postmenopausal ladies expertise some extent of feminine sample hair loss.

Fortunately, hair loss is mostly not thought-about harmful, in keeping with Jeffrey M. Cohen, MD, Yale Medicine dermatologist.

However, Cohen says it may be an indication of an underlying medical situation that does current well being dangers, equivalent to hypothyroidism

Additionally, he notes that hair loss may cause a psychological impression and be emotionally taxing for many who determine as ladies, which might lead to anxiety and depression.

Here’s what to find out about frequent causes of hair loss in ladies, in addition to how it may be handled and prevented. 

Types of hair loss in ladies

Here are among the most typical varieties of hair loss

  1. Androgenetic alopecia — in any other case often called feminine sample hair loss — is the commonest sort of hair loss in ladies, and it includes hair thinning on the highest and sides of the top. 
  2. Telogen effluvium is the second most common. It’s normally triggered by stress, which causes a sudden surge within the variety of dormant hair follicles, thus resulting in elevated shedding. It also can come after you have skilled a excessive fever or sickness, which is why many individuals have reported hair shedding after contracting COVID-19.
  3. Anagen effluvium is speedy hair loss brought on by drugs, equivalent to chemotherapy medicine.
  4. Alopecia areata is an autoimmune condition through which the immune system assaults the hair follicles. It typically causes hair loss in patches, however also can have an effect on the complete scalp or physique.

What causes alopecia?

There are many various causes for hair loss in ladies. Some of the commonest are the next:

Genetics 

Female sample baldness, particularly, has been discovered to run in families. If your parents have pattern baldness, you are extra more likely to expertise it. 

While research has discovered a robust hyperlink between hair loss in males and the AR gene on the “X” chromosome, researchers have yet to isolate a particular gene for hair loss in ladies.

Researchers suppose that alopecia areata is perhaps genetic, but it surely may be brought on by environmental elements, equivalent to stress.

Menopause

Post-menopausal ladies sometimes expertise thinning hair, says Alexander Zuriarrain, MD, a double board-certified plastic surgeon with Zuri Plastic Surgery

In reality, as much as two-thirds of women expertise hair thinning or bald spots after menopause

This occurs as a result of throughout menopause, ladies produce less estrogen and progesterone, which set off a rise within the manufacturing of androgens. Androgens are thought-about to be male hormones which are linked to shrinking hair follicles and hair loss.

Nutrient deficiencies

A 2021 study discovered that vitamin D performs a key function in hair development, and that deficiency on this vitamin is linked to androgenetic alopecia and telogen effluvium, amongst different varieties of alopecia. 

Vitamin D deficiency is quite common, affecting 41.6% of US adults — however you may simply get extra of this nutrient by foods like salmon, mushrooms, egg yolks, fortified orange juice and milk. You also can take an over-the-counter supplement if you don’t choose these meals. 

An iron deficiency also can contribute to hair loss, says Zuriarrain, so it is a good suggestion to include iron-rich foods like lentils and beans, fortified milk, and spinach, or different darkish leafy greens into your weight-reduction plan. You also can strive a supplement.

How do docs diagnose alopecia?

A physical exam by a dermatologist or different healthcare supplier can reveal what sort of hair loss you could have, which is able to decide the beneficial therapy. 

Your physician could visually study your scalp and gently tug on small sections of hair — if six or extra strands come out, which will indicate you have telogen effluvium, anagen effluvium, or early androgenetic alopecia.

Usually, a dermatologist will be capable of determine the sort and reason behind hair loss throughout a bodily examination, but when they want extra information for a analysis — for instance, in the event that they discover lesions on the scalp — they could conduct blood tests or a scalp biopsy.

Blood checks can verify for: 

  • Hormone ranges to rule out underlying causes like thyroid illness or menopause.
  • Vitamin or mineral deficiencies to rule out autoimmune ailments which may have an effect on your potential to soak up vitamins. 

A biopsy sometimes entails puncturing the scalp to take away a small pattern of tissue, which is then submitted for testing. A lab evaluation of the pattern may help to determine which type of hair loss you have.

“Women who expertise hair loss not related to being pregnant or stress must be evaluated by their major care physicians to rule out different causes of hair loss equivalent to thyroid illness, anemia, autoimmune ailments, polycystic ovarian syndrome, psoriasis, and seborrheic dermatitis,” says Zuriarrain.

Hair loss remedies

The proper therapy for hair loss relies on the trigger. Zuriarrain says hair loss associated to hormonal modifications from being pregnant or stress is normally solely non permanent, and subsequently could require you to attend to provide start or take steps to mitigate your stress levels so as to deal with it.

If your hair loss appears to be triggered by one thing else, it’s possible you’ll contemplate dietary supplements or drugs. But not all dietary supplements available on the market could have scientific backing. Here are among the ones that do:

  • Vitamin D: A 2019 review discovered vitamin D dietary supplements may help enhance androgenetic alopecia and telogen effluvium, two of the commonest varieties of hair loss. 
  • Omega 3 and 6 plus antioxidants: A small 2015 study discovered {that a} complement with omega fatty acids together with antioxidants helped to enhance hair density. Of the contributors who took this complement for six months, 89.9% reported a discount in hair loss. If you could have an iron deficiency, supplementing with this mineral could assist to sluggish or cease hair loss. 
  • Viviscal: A 2015 study of ladies with self-perceived thinning hair discovered that taking the pure marine collagen protein complement Viviscal for 90 days decreased hair shedding whereas bettering hair high quality and energy. 
  • Nutrafol: A 2018 study discovered {that a} “significant percentage” of topics who took the plant-based complement Nutrafol noticed an enchancment in hair development, quantity, thickness, and hair development price.

As for drugs, the one FDA-approved hair loss treatment for each women and men is Minoxidil (2% or 5%). This treatment is offered over-the-counter and utilized topically to the scalp, however could take a number of months till you see outcomes. 

“Minoxidil helps by keeping the hair in the strongest part of the hair cycle to improve the overall thickness of the hair,” says Cohen. “This can be very safe and very effective for women with hair loss.”

Another prescription hair loss medication is Spironolactone, a kind of steroid that hinders the effects of androgens in the body and tends to be simpler for ladies who expertise pre-menopausal hair loss. 

Corticosteroids are generally used to suppress the immune system and treat alopecia areata. They can both be utilized topically or injected straight into the scalp. While corticosteroids could not deal with the situation fully, they’ve been discovered to moderately improve hair development in adults and youngsters.

Beyond dietary supplements and drugs, different therapy choices embody:

  • Hormone alternative remedy: For postmenopausal ladies, hormone replacement therapies, like Prempro, are a standard prescription treatment. 
  • Laser remedy: A small 2020 study discovered that low-level laser therapy elevated hair density in sufferers with androgenetic alopecia. FDA-approved at-home gadgets embody the HairMax Lasercomb and the Theradome LH80 PRO helmet.
  • Hair transplants are a type of surgical therapy that includes grafting hair onto thinning or balding areas. However, it requires you to have a patch of sturdy hair development from which grafts might be pulled. For most, that is sometimes the again of the top.

How to stop hair loss

It’s unlikely you can forestall hair loss associated to getting older, heredity, or illness, says Cohen.

However, in case your hair loss is brought on by one thing that is extra associated to life-style, then there are related life-style modifications you may make to cut back your threat: 

  • Maintain a well-balanced weight-reduction plan that meets all of your vitamin and mineral necessities
  • Reduce stress in your on a regular basis life 
  • Quit smoking 
  • Avoid tight hairstyles or hair merchandise laden with chemical substances and sulfates, which might all contribute to traction alopecia
